You hate to see this before the season officially begins.  Lakers star small forward LeBron James is going to be sidelined for at least 3-4 weeks due to sciatica on his right side.

I am placing bets on this as Dunk of the Year (too soon?).  The Pelicans’ Zion Williamson threw down a filthy slam on the Spurs’ Victor Wembanyama.  This comes as the Spurs beat the Pelicans, 120-116, in overtime.

What a thriller tonight in Minneapolis!  Austin Reaves nailed the first game-winning buzzer-beater of the NBA season as the Lakers avoided a 20-point collapse, against the Timberwolves, 116-115.
